[Postoperative anosmia after microsurgery for anterior circulation aneurysms]
M E Margulis1, Yu V Pilipenko1, E V Shelesko1
1Burdenko Neurosurgery Center, Moscow, Russia.
Objective:
To analyze the factors contributing to postoperative anosmia and to evaluate the effectiveness of preventive strategies in microsurgery for cerebral aneurysms.
Material And Methods:
The study included 117 patients with unruptured anterior circulation aneurysms who underwent surgery at the Burdenko Neurosurgery Center in 2024-2025. All patients underwent olfactometric assessment preoperatively, after 5-7 postoperative days and 6 months after surgery. Clinical, anatomical (CT angiography) and intraoperative factors were analyzed.
Results:
Postoperative anosmia occurred in 55 (47%) patients with bilateral involvement in 11 (20%) cases. Anosmia developed in 70.2% of patients with anterior communicating artery (ACoA) aneurysms. Significant anatomical predictors were superior (p=0.01) and anterior (p=0.01) ACoA aneurysm dome orientation. Intraoperative risk factors included nerve compression by brain spatula (p<0.001) and arachnoid dissection of the nerve. In some cases, we noted a single-stage flow of blood along anterior cranial fossa base from olfactory tract during frontal lobe traction and arterial dissection. This «red drop» sign was an intraoperative marker of nerve injury (p=0.04). Transsylvian approach for middle cerebral artery aneurysms ensured 100% preservation of olfactory function (p<0.001). After 6 months, olfactory function recovered in 33.3% of patients. Previous COVID-19 was associated with worse recovery (p=0.05).
Conclusion:
Postoperative anosmia is a frequent complication in aneurysm surgery. The main predictors are ACoA aneurysm and intraoperative traction-induced avulsion of the nerve. Preventive strategies include selection of less traumatic approach and minimized pressure on olfactory nerve. Arachnoid dissection of the nerve is not recommended.
